farce

US: fɑːrs
UK: fɑːs
noun

Cambridge Dictionary

View on Cambridge →
noun

1.a humorous play or film where the characters become involved in unlikely situations

2.the style of writing or acting in this type of play

The play suddenly changes from farce to tragedy.

3.a situation that is very badly organized or unfair

No one had prepared anything so the meeting was a bit of a farce.

4.a humorous play in which the characters become involved in unlikely situations, or the humor in this type of play

5.a ridiculous situation or event, or something considered a waste of time

The meeting turned out to be a farce since no one had prepared anything.
